What Is a Hybrid Cloud?

Combining private and public cloud systems results in a hybrid cloud. It facilitates the smooth transfer of apps and data between the two. The advantages of both worlds—the scalability of public clouds and the security of private ones—are offered by this flexibility.

A business might, for instance, use a public cloud for intense data processing activities and keep sensitive customer data in a private cloud. Businesses may function more efficiently thanks to this balance without compromising performance or control.

How Hybrid Clouds Accelerate Computing

1. Dynamic Distribution of Workload

Intelligent workload distribution is a feature of hybrid clouds. While less demanding jobs stay on private clouds, those that require more processing power can move to public cloud services. This keeps any one system from being overloaded.

2. Flexibility in Scalability

Scalability is one of the most significant benefits. Need more processing power for a large project or during a busy time of year? With hybrid clouds, scaling up is instantaneous. You can scale back down to ensure cost effectiveness once demand has subsided.

3. Enhanced Resource Efficiency

Hybrid configurations maximize the use of both software and hardware. Performance is improved and waste is avoided by allocating resources according to current demands. It’s similar to having a personal assistant to make sure everything goes without a hitch.

Applications of Hybrid Clouds

1. Scientific Research 

To perform intricate simulations, scientists utilize hybrid clouds. For instance, these systems are necessary for weather models to make precise predictions about climate change.

2. Online shopping

Large volumes of data are handled by retailers on sales occasions such as Black Friday. Without any downtime, hybrid clouds handle surges in website traffic.

3. Services for Finance

Large datasets are analyzed by banks and other financial institutions to identify fraud and assess risks. Hybrid clouds guarantee the speed and security of these calculations.

4. Entertainment & Media

Hybrid clouds offer the processing capacity required to satisfy customer demands, from producing HD videos to live-streaming events. 

Challenges of Hybrid Clouds

While hybrid clouds are powerful, they’re not without challenges:

  1. Complex Management: Managing multiple environments can be tricky.
  2. Integration Issues: Ensuring seamless integration between private and public clouds takes effort.
  3. Compliance Risks: Data regulations must be carefully followed, especially when moving data between clouds.
